A look at the shareholders of Red Avenue New Materials Group Co., Ltd. (SHSE:603650) can tell us which group is most powerful. The group holding the most number of shares in the company, around 63% to be precise, is individual insiders. In other words, the group stands to gain the most (or lose the most) from their investment into the company.

Red Avenue New Materials Group is not owned by hedge funds. The company's largest shareholder is Ning Zhang, with ownership of 63%. This implies that they have majority interest control of the future of the company. Meanwhile, the second and third largest shareholders, hold 5.2% and 3.0%, of the shares outstanding, respectively.

It seems that insiders own more than half the Red Avenue New Materials Group Co., Ltd. stock. This gives them a lot of power. Given it has a market cap of CN¥19b, that means insiders have a whopping CN¥12b worth of shares in their own names. Most would argue this is a positive, showing strong alignment with shareholders.
